Searched refs:smem (Results 1 – 6 of 6) sorted by relevance
/optee_os/core/arch/arm/mm/ |
A D | sp_mem.c | 180 struct sp_mem *smem = NULL; in sp_mem_get() local 189 return smem; in sp_mem_get() 206 struct sp_mem *smem = NULL; in sp_mem_new() local 210 smem = calloc(sizeof(*smem), 1); in sp_mem_new() 211 if (!smem) in sp_mem_new() 219 free(smem); in sp_mem_new() 228 SLIST_INIT(&smem->regions); in sp_mem_new() 233 return smem; in sp_mem_new() 282 if (!smem) in sp_mem_remove() 311 if (tsmem == smem) { in sp_mem_remove() [all …]
|
A D | tee_pager.c | 383 vaddr_t smem = tee_mm_get_smem(mm); in tee_pager_set_alias_area() local 388 DMSG("0x%" PRIxVA " - 0x%" PRIxVA, smem, smem + nbytes); in tee_pager_set_alias_area() 392 pager_alias_next_free = smem; in tee_pager_set_alias_area() 395 pt = find_pager_table(smem); in tee_pager_set_alias_area() 400 if (v >= (smem + nbytes)) in tee_pager_set_alias_area() 2000 uint8_t *smem = NULL; in tee_pager_alloc() local 2022 asan_tag_access(smem, smem + num_pages * SMALL_PAGE_SIZE); in tee_pager_alloc() 2024 return smem; in tee_pager_alloc() 2030 uint8_t *smem = NULL; in tee_pager_init_iv_region() local 2042 asan_tag_access(smem, smem + fobj->num_pages * SMALL_PAGE_SIZE); in tee_pager_init_iv_region() [all …]
|
/optee_os/core/arch/arm/kernel/ |
A D | spmc_sp_handler.c | 69 struct sp_mem *smem) in find_sp_mem_receiver() argument 92 struct sp_mem *smem) in add_mem_region_to_sp() argument 117 receiver->smem = smem; in add_mem_region_to_sp() 288 if (!smem) in spmc_sp_add_share() 359 sp_mem_add(smem); in spmc_sp_add_share() 364 sp_mem_remove(smem); in spmc_sp_add_share() 517 if (!smem) { in ffa_mem_retrieve() 608 if (!smem) { in ffa_mem_relinquish() 695 smem = sp_mem_get(handle); in ffa_mem_reclaim() 696 if (!smem) in ffa_mem_reclaim() [all …]
|
A D | secure_partition.c | 237 struct sp_mem *smem, in sp_map_shared() argument 267 SLIST_FOREACH(reg, &smem->regions, link) { in sp_map_shared() 279 TEE_Result sp_unmap_ffa_regions(struct sp_session *s, struct sp_mem *smem) in sp_unmap_ffa_regions() argument 287 SLIST_FOREACH(reg, &smem->regions, link) { in sp_unmap_ffa_regions()
|
/optee_os/core/include/mm/ |
A D | sp_mem.h | 26 struct sp_mem *smem; member 73 struct sp_mem_receiver *sp_mem_get_receiver(uint32_t s_id, struct sp_mem *smem); 80 void sp_mem_add(struct sp_mem *smem);
|
/optee_os/core/arch/arm/include/kernel/ |
A D | secure_partition.h | 88 TEE_Result sp_unmap_ffa_regions(struct sp_session *s, struct sp_mem *smem);
|
Completed in 13 milliseconds